About The Team
The Alfred Care Group Clinical Trials Pharmacy Service provides quality, productive and cost-effective investigational drug services across all four of our campuses. The department is based at the Alfred and oversees the quality and governance and financial management of over 300 trials both commercial and local investigator led.
The Clinical Trials Pharmacy plays a key role in the whole clinical trials process from ethics submission through to audits and inspections from international regulatory bodies, to clinically screening and reviewing patients in the hospital.
